About Z. G. Soos

Z. G. Soos is a scholar working on Physical and Theoretical Chemistry, Electronic, Optical and Magnetic Materials and Biophysics, having authored 35 papers that have together received 929 indexed citations. Recurring topics across this work include Organic and Molecular Conductors Research (10 papers), Organic Electronics and Photovoltaics (6 papers) and Photochemistry and Electron Transfer Studies (6 papers). The work is most often cited by research in Electronic, Optical and Magnetic Materials (390 citations), Physical and Theoretical Chemistry (149 citations) and Condensed Matter Physics (126 citations). Z. G. Soos has collaborated with scholars based in United States, India and Brazil. Frequent co-authors include R. C. Hughes, G. W. Hayden, Satoru Kuwajima, S. Etemad, S. Ramasesha, Debasis Mukhopadhyay, S. Ramasesha, Joan Selverstone Valentine, Douglas S. Galvão and B. Morosin. Their work appears in journals such as Journal of the American Chemical Society, Physical Review Letters and The Journal of Chemical Physics.
